CVE-2017-7603
CVE-2017-7603 is a high-severity vulnerability in Libaacplus Project Libaacplus with a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-190.

Description
au_channel.h in HE-AAC+ Codec (aka libaacplus) 2.0.2 has a signed integer overflow, which might all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) or possibly have unspecified other impact via a crafted audio file.
